Simple mail and a helping hand could catch more liver cancer early

NCT ID NCT06635694

Summary

This study is testing whether sending mailed reminders and providing a patient guide can help more people with liver cirrhosis or chronic hepatitis B attend their regular liver cancer screening appointments. Researchers want to see if this support helps catch cancer at an earlier, more treatable stage compared to the current standard of care. The study involves 652 participants in the UK who are at high risk for liver cancer.
